Abstract
Accident at the Chernobyl nuclear power plant (NPP) in April 1986 appeared to be one of most serious ecological catastrophes. It led to the nuclear pollution of vast surrounding territories and had severe global ecological consequences. In their report the authors investigate manifestation of footprints of the nuclear catastrophe on the SIR-C/X SAR images of the NPP area obtained 8 years since the accident. Coniferous forests in the area of nuclear power plant may be used as a descriptor of the level and spatial distribution of nuclear pollution using SAR data. L-band SAR data seem to be one of the most useful for the purpose of monitoring of the Chernobyl forests state
